#7da532 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7da532 is composed of 49% red, 64.7%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 80.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 42.2%. #7da532 color hex could be obtained by blending #faff64 with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#7da532 color description : Dark moderate green.
#7da532 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7da532 has RGB values of R:125, G:165,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 8234290.
